
Mon Jan 06 18:53:46 UTC 2025: ## Delhi on High Alert After Karnataka HMPV Cases
**New Delhi, January 7, 2025** – Following two reported cases of Human Metapneumovirus (HMPV) in Karnataka, Delhi’s Health Minister Saurabh Bharadwaj has ordered a city-wide preparedness drive. The directive, issued in line with advice from the Union Health Ministry, mandates that all hospitals be ready for a potential surge in respiratory illnesses.
To ensure readiness, the Health Secretary has been tasked with daily inspections of three hospitals, submitting reports on medicine and ICU bed availability, equipment condition, and the functionality of Pressure Swing Absorption (PSA) oxygen plants. A parallel advisory from the Directorate General of Health Services (DGHS) instructs hospital administrators to immediately isolate suspected HMPV cases, designate facilities for severe cases requiring ventilator support, and educate medical staff on the virus.
AAP national convener Arvind Kejriwal took to X, urging immediate central intervention and emphasizing the importance of early containment, drawing parallels to the COVID-19 pandemic. The Delhi government’s proactive measures aim to prevent a potential health emergency.
